1Key Financial Results and Metrics

Q3 2025 Revenue: RMB 9.1 million, a decline attributed to lower sales of mining machines due to market stabilization.

9-Month 2025 Revenue: RMB 184.7 million ($25.9 million), down 11% year-over-year.

Loss from Operations: RMB 41.8 million for Q3; RMB 21 million for the first nine months compared to a profit of RMB 39.8 million in the same period last year.

Cost of Revenue: Increased by 42.9% to RMB 108.2 million due to impairment charges on excess inventory.

Net Income: RMB 78.7 million for the first nine months, up from RMB 38.7 million in 2024, driven by a substantial gain in cryptocurrency fair value (RMB 79.3 million).

Cash Position: $66.5 million in cash and equivalents as of September 30, 2025.

2Strategic Updates and Business Highlights

Business Focus: Primarily on cryptocurrency mining machines, with ongoing development in ETH accumulation and Web3 applications.

R&D Investment: Approximately $9 million year-to-date, emphasizing technological advancements and product innovation.

Product Launches:

Launched ALEO miner series and Goldshell Byte mining machine.

Introduced XTM mining service in September 2025, expected to contribute significantly to Q4 revenue.

ETH Strategy: Holding 9,919 ETH valued at approximately $37 million; paused purchases in Q3 but exploring yield generation through a partnership with FalconX.

3Forward Guidance and Outlook

2026 Growth Strategy: Focus on launching new products, including a Dogecoin mining machine expected in H1 2026, with anticipated revenue contributions in H2 2026.

Staking Platform Acquisition: Aiming to enhance blockchain infrastructure capabilities and diversify staking services across multiple blockchains.

R&D Outlook: Anticipated decrease in R&D expenses in Q4 2025, with plans to optimize spending in 2026.

4Bad News, Challenges, or Points of Concern

Revenue Decline: Notable drop in Q3 revenue and ongoing challenges due to cyclical volatility in the cryptocurrency market.

Operational Losses: Significant losses reported for Q3 and the first nine months, contrasting sharply with previous profitability.

Market Demand: Softer demand for mining machines and potential risks associated with fluctuating cryptocurrency prices could impact future performance.

5Notable Q&A Insights

Dogecoin Mining Machine: Expected launch in the first half of 2026, with revenue contributions anticipated in the second half.

Staking Platform Marketing: Plans to brand the new staking platform under Intchains or Goldshell, with further details to be provided post-acquisition.

R&D Spending: Q4 R&D expenses expected to decrease as no new chip developments are anticipated; future strategies to reduce overall R&D costs were mentioned.
